Abstract
Norms constitute a powerful coordination mechanism among heterogeneous agents. We propose means to specify and explicitly manage the normative positions of agents (permissions, prohibitions and obligations), with which distinct deontic notions and their relationships can be captured. Our rule-based formalism includes constraints for more expressiveness and precision and allows the norm-oriented programming of electronic institutions: normative aspects are given a precise computational interpretation. Our formalism has been conceived as a machine language to which other higher-level normative languages can be mapped, allowing their execution.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Wooldridge, M.: An Introduction to Multiagent Systems. John Wiley & Sons, Chichester, UK (2002)
Dignum, F.: Autonomous Agents with Norms. Artificial Intelligence and Law 7(1), 69–79 (1999)
López y López, F.: Social Power and Norms: Impact on agent behaviour. PhD thesis, Univ. of Southampton (2003)
Sergot, M.: A Computational Theory of Normative Positions. ACM Trans. Comput. Logic 2(4), 581–622 (2001)
Shoham, Y., Tennenholtz, M.: On Social Laws for Artificial Agent Societies: Off-line Design. Artificial Intelligence 73(1-2), 231–252 (1995)
Artikis, A., Kamara, L., Pitt, J., Sergot, M.: A Protocol for Resource Sharing in Norm-Governed Ad Hoc Networks. In: Leite, J.A., Omicini, A., Torroni, P., Yolum, p. (eds.) DALT 2004. LNCS (LNAI), vol. 3476, Springer, Heidelberg (2005)
Cranefield, S.: A Rule Language for Modelling and Monitoring Social Expectations in Multi-Agent Systems. Technical Report 2005/01, Univ. of Otago (2005)
Fornara, N., Viganò, F., Colombetti, M.: An Event Driven Approach to Norms in Artificial Institutions. In: Boissier, O., Padget, J., Dignum, V., Lindemann, G., Matson, E., Ossowski, S., Sichman, J.S., Vázquez-Salceda, J. (eds.) Coordination, Organizations, Institutions, and Norms in Multi-Agent Systems. LNCS (LNAI), vol. 3913, pp. 142–154. Springer, Heidelberg (2006)
García-Camino, A., Noriega, P., Rodríguez-Aguilar, J.A.: Implementing Norms in Electronic Institutions. In: Procs. 4th AAMAS (2005)
García-Camino, A., Rodríguez-Aguilar, J.A., Sierra, C., Vasconcelos, W.: A Distributed Architecture for Norm-Aware Agent Societies. In: Baldoni, M., Endriss, U., Omicini, A., Torroni, P. (eds.) DALT 2005. LNCS (LNAI), vol. 3904, Springer, Heidelberg (2006)
Searle, J.: Speech Acts, An Essay in the Philosophy of Language. Cambridge University Press, Cambridge (1969)
Esteva, M.: Electronic Institutions: from Specification to Development. PhD thesis, Universitat Politècnica de Catalunya (UPC), IIIA monography, vol. 19 (2003)
Jaffar, J., Maher, M.J.: Constraint Logic Programming: A Survey. Journal of Logic Progr. 19/20, 503–581 (1994)
Fitting, M.: First-Order Logic and Automated Theorem Proving. Springer, New York, USA (1990)
Noriega, P.: Agent-Mediated Auctions: The Fishmarket Metaphor. PhD thesis, Universitat Autònoma de Barcelona (UAB), IIIA monography, vol. 8 (1997)
Vázquez-Salceda, J., Aldewereld, H., Dignum, F.: Implementing Norms in Multiagent Systems. In: Lindemann, G., Denzinger, J., Timm, I.J., Unland, R. (eds.) MATES 2004. LNCS (LNAI), vol. 3187, Springer, Heidelberg (2004)
Alberti, M., Gavanelli, M., Lamma, E., Mello, P., Torroni, P.: Specification and Verification of Agent Interactions using Integrity Social Constraints. Technical Report DEIS-LIA-006-03, University of Bologna (2003)
Cliffe, O., De Vos, M., Padget, J.: Specifying and Analysing Agent-based Social Institutions using Answer Set Programming. In: Boissier, O., Padget, J., Dignum, V., Lindemann, G., Matson, E., Ossowski, S., Sichman, J.S., Vázquez-Salceda, J. (eds.) Coordination, Organizations, Institutions, and Norms in Multi-Agent Systems. LNCS (LNAI), vol. 3913, pp. 99–113. Springer, Heidelberg (2006)
Baral, C.: Knowledge Representation, Reasoning and Declarative Problem Solving. Cambridge Press, Cambridge (2003)
Lopes Cardoso, H., Oliveira, E.: Towards an Institutional Environment using Norms for Contract Performance. LNCS (LNAI). Springer, Heidelberg (in press)
Forgy, C.: Rete: a fast algorithm for the many pattern/many object pattern match problem. Artificial Intelligence 19(1), 17–37 (1982)
Gelfond, M., Lifschitz, V.: Representing action and change by logic programs. Journal of Logic Programming 17, 301–321 (1993)
Vasconcelos, W.W.: Norm Verification and Analysis of Electronic Institutions. In: Leite, J.A., Omicini, A., Torroni, P., Yolum, P. (eds.) DALT 2004. LNCS (LNAI), vol. 3476, Springer, Heidelberg (2005)
Author information
Authors and Affiliations
Editor information
Rights and permissions
Copyright information
© 2007 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
García-Camino, A., Rodríguez-Aguilar, JA., Sierra, C., Vasconcelos, W. (2007). Norm-Oriented Programming of Electronic Institutions: A Rule-Based Approach. In: Noriega, P., et al. Coordination, Organizations, Institutions, and Norms in Agent Systems II. COIN 2006. Lecture Notes in Computer Science(), vol 4386.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-74459-7_12
Download citation
DOI: https://doi.org/10.1007/978-3-540-74459-7_12
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-74457-3
Online ISBN: 978-3-540-74459-7
eBook Packages: Computer ScienceComputer Science (R0)